"morfina" meaning in Portuguese

See morfina in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/moʁˈfĩ.nɐ/ [Brazil], [mohˈfĩ.nɐ] [Brazil], /moʁˈfĩ.nɐ/ [Brazil], [mohˈfĩ.nɐ] [Brazil], /moɾˈfĩ.nɐ/ [São-Paulo], /moʁˈfĩ.nɐ/ [Rio-de-Janeiro], [moχˈfĩ.nɐ] [Rio-de-Janeiro], /moɻˈfi.na/ [Southern-Brazil], /muɾˈfi.nɐ/ [Portugal] Forms: morfinas [plural]
Head templates: {{pt-noun|f}} morfina f (plural morfinas)
  1. (biochemistry, pharmacology) morphine (opioid used as an anaesthetic or recreational drug) Tags: feminine Categories (topical): Alkaloids, Biochemistry, Pharmaceutical drugs, Recreational drugs
